Observations from my first Metaverse game
Just finished my first MV game as the Terrans on a small galaxy, challenging difficulty, all abundant, rare extreme planets and tech brokering off.
The final score of approx 20000 wasn't too bad, but it did put in perspective the efforts required to get large scores. I don't think I will be doing that. I noticed a few things:
- The AIs were pathetic, absolutely pathetic. I am hoping the Tough one will be a LOT better. The Draths were actually building defenders with only defence! It is possible the tech inflation got to them.
- My approval rating was 100% at 49% tax rate for a large part of the game, with just one morale resource. In fact, even when a a vast majority of my planets were nearing 14B, I had 92% approval with Evil alignment. That neutralises a big advantage of going neutral.
-With lots of planets, trade is just a diplomatic tool.
-Tourism is very good until your taxes get going. Even later, money from tourism was small but not insignificant.
-High taxes are still the key source of money ![]()
-Tech inflation really hurt the AI. As does disabling tech brokering.
-The MCC alone justifies Evil alignment. I mean, when you have to mop up scores of planets, it might be fastest to just run through the influence module techs and build influence starbases. A single starbase can flip 5-6 planets. I doubt if it will give you a high score though.
-Miniaturization is a very important tech.
-I see no benefit to having 20B pop instead of 14B. The increase in tax is nominal and easily offset by the extra morale buildings required. Better to put a couple of stock exchanges instead. Except for building up invasion forces quickly. And a larger score probably.
-I still don't know how to manage my sliders efficiently. Except when I put them on 100% research! ![]()
-Either I had really bad luck or Creativity isn't as useful as it is made out to be. Still worth the 1 point though.
-Economy and Morale are still the best abilites to put your points into.
-Federalists and Technologists are the best. Not sure about the Luck+Universalist combo.
